Australian rockabilly is a sunburnt, high-octane take on 1950s rock ’n’ roll, blending slap-back echo guitars, upright bass thump, and snappy backbeats with the swagger of pub rock and the wide-open feel of coastal highways. It nods to Memphis twang and early country, but often adds sharper edge, faster tempos, and a cheeky, larrikin attitude—equal parts dancefloor jive and barroom grit. Songs lean on tales of hot rods, heartbreak, and good-time rebellion, delivered with bold vocals, tight band swing, and a DIY spirit that keeps the scene loud, stylish, and relentlessly fun.
